Transaction 68bf11c50475357fdc3692739a1ad11307d1414e21375dba47845fe73f93a623

1 Input
2 Outputs
  • 68bf11c50475357fdc3692739a1ad11307d1414e21375dba47845fe73f93a623:0
  • value  120787
    address  18CXEt8dDSDQCPmsGnCXuRQSHPwzDS67kg
  • 68bf11c50475357fdc3692739a1ad11307d1414e21375dba47845fe73f93a623:1
  • value  112752845
    address  3CW9PzNKbmm9hJ93jBnHs2i6n2VJrXu3uu